Evvie at sixteen

By Pfeffer, Susan Beth

Publishers Summary:
Eldest daughter in an unusual family, Evvie goes to spend the summer with a bedridden great-aunt, whose plutocratic and acerbic views affect her relationship with two boys she meets--one divinely handsome, the other possessing a dark mystery.

Gr 7-12 Sixteen-year-old Evvie, the oldest of the four Sebastian sisters, spends the summer in a resort town helping her Great-aunt Grace, who has broken her leg. Although intimidated by this aunt who has always disapproved of Evvie's father, Evvie has the good sense and wit to sidestep Grace's opinionated lectures, and Grace comes to depend on Evvie for companionship.
